Shadows of the Alchemist's Heart
The air was thick with the scent of herbs and ancient lore, the kind that could only be found within the walls of the Alchemist's Tower, a place where time seemed to stand still. Inside, Elara, a young alchemist with a heart as fierce as her spirit, moved with the grace of a seasoned master. Her fingers danced over the cauldron, each motion precise and calculated, as she worked on a potion that held the promise of great power. But this was no ordinary potion; it was a love potion, a creation forbidden by the very code she lived by.
In the adjacent laboratory, Lysander, a sorcerer whose power was matched only by his charm, watched Elara from the shadows. Their eyes met across the room, and for a moment, time seemed to stop. Their love was as forbidden as the potion she was crafting, but it was too strong to ignore.
Elara's mother, the head alchemist of the tower, had always warned her of the dangers of love, of how it could blind even the most rational of hearts. But Elara knew her heart well, and it was filled with a love for Lysander that transcended reason. She had to complete the potion, to give him the love he craved, even if it meant risking everything.
As the potion reached its boiling point, the air crackled with energy. Elara's heart raced with anticipation, her fingers trembling as she added the final ingredient—a rare, magical flower that could ignite even the coldest of hearts. With a final stir of her wand, the potion glowed with a warm, inviting light.
Lysander stepped forward, his eyes wide with wonder and a touch of fear. "Elara, this is madness. What if it doesn't work?"
She smiled, her voice steady despite the turmoil within. "It will work, Lysander. Our love is worth the risk."
As they shared the potion, their connection deepened, the love between them growing stronger with each passing moment. But as the magic took hold, the air around them grew heavy, the walls of the tower trembling with the force of the transformation.
The Alchemist's Tower had always been a place of balance, a sanctuary where alchemy and magic coexisted in harmony. Now, that balance was threatened. The love potion had not only ignited their hearts but had also released a dark force, one that threatened to consume the world.
The alchemist's mother, who had been watching from a distance, rushed to the cauldron. "Elara, stop! This is too much!"
But it was too late. The dark force had spread, the shadows growing longer and more menacing. The tower's defenses, once so strong, now faltered. The alchemist's mother turned to Lysander, her voice filled with urgency. "You must leave, Lysander. Take the potion with you and use it to break the bond!"
Lysander hesitated, torn between his love for Elara and the danger she now posed to the world. "But Elara, what will you do?"
Elara stepped forward, her eyes blazing with determination. "I will find a way to reverse the potion. I will save us all."
The alchemist's mother nodded, her eyes filled with respect. "Then do it, Elara. But be quick."
With a heart heavy with love and fear, Elara began her quest to reverse the potion, to undo the damage and restore balance to the world. She knew that her journey would be fraught with peril, that she might not return, but her love for Lysander and her duty as an alchemist were too great to abandon.
As she set out, the shadows of the Alchemist's Tower loomed large, a reminder of the transformation that had begun. The world was on the brink of change, and Elara's love would either be the spark that ignited a new era or the flame that would consume everything.
In the end, it was not the potion that would determine the fate of the realms, but the strength of Elara's heart and the resilience of her love. Would she succeed in her quest, or would the shadows consume them all? The answer lay in the depths of her journey, a journey that would test the limits of her love and the power of her alchemy.
